T>IAKO ANNUAL RACES. TO BE BUN AT MORRINSVILLE, ON WEDNESDAY, MARCH 17, 1880,

Stewards : Mesera. J. Tumbull, S Ticklepenny, Jas. Rowe, H. Campbell, C. Collins, Jas. Taylor, H Burbridge J. Wood. Judoe: H. P. Chepmell, Esq., J.P. Starter: T. G. Sandes, Esq. Clerks of Course: R. Parr, Esq. A. Ticklepenny, R«.q. Clerk of Scales : S. Tieklepenny, Esq Handkjappbr: T. Weatherill, Esq. Secretary : T. Kowe. PROGRAMME. Ist Eace to start at 11.30. a.m. Hurdle Race (Handicap) of loeovs : with a sweep of lsov. for starters only, sweep to go to second horse ; 1^ miles over 6 flights of hurdles, 3ft. 6ins high. Nomination £1 Acceptance lsov. 2. Maiden Plate of 12sovs: l' f miles, weight for age, for three year olds and upwards that have never won a stake (matches excepted), exceeding «ssovs. Entrance lsov. 3. Piako Handicap of 30sovs: sweepstakes of 2sovs. each to go to second horse, distance 2 miles. Nomination lsov. .Acceptance Usove. 4. Trotting Race (Distance Handicap) lOsovs : distance 3 miles, pull and go second horse to save his stake. Nomination 10s. Acceptance 10s. 5. Selling Hack Rack of lOsovs : 1 mile ■weight 10 fit. Winner to be sold for 15sovs. Surplus to go to Race Fund. Post entries 15s. 6. Maori Race. Prize saddle & bridle value 7 guineas. 1 mile; heats; catch weights; horses to be owned and ridden by Maories only. 7. The Final Fitttter of Ssovs: no weight under 7st.; \ mile. Post entries 15s. 8. Consolaiion Handicap of Bsovs: 1^ miles for all beaten horses. Nomination ss. Acceptance 10s. Nominations for handicaps (Hurdles, Handicap, and Trot), to be sent addressed to '• T. G. Sandes, Box 27, Hamilton Post-office " (or by telegram), on or before Saturday, February 28th, 1880, at 8 p.m. Weights will be published on Tuesday, the 2nd of March, 1880, in the Waikato Times. I Acceptances and general entries to be made on or before Friday, the 12th March, at 8 p.m., addressed as above. All jockeys, except those in the Maori Race, riack Race, and Flutter, to ride in colors or they will not be pprmitted to start. No entry will be received without being accompanied by the requisite amount of cash, nor later than the time named. In all post entry races four horses to start or no prize will be given. Waikato Turf Club rules will be strictly adhered to in all matters connected with the meeting. Entries t:> state name and age of horse, also pedigree so far as known, and colors of riders. No entry will be received for any of the races except upon this condition: That all disputes, claims, asd objections arising out of the racing shall be decided by a majority of the Stewards present, or those whom they may appoint. Their decision upon all points connected with the carrying out of this programme shall he final. Protests to be accompanied by 1 boy., which will be forfeited if the protest is not sustained. Qualification subscription for Nos. 1 , 2, 3, and 4, 105 ; for 0, 6, and 7, ss. If funds will permit, stakes will be increased pro ritta.
